Independent generation has a long history in Portugal. Nevertheless the legal framework for licensing and interconnection was the same for a generator of 1kW and for a 50MW power station. In 2008, DL 363 entered in force and it was specifically aimed for microgeneration: (1) Easy internet registration; (2) Simplified licence; (3) Standard equipment; (4) Up to 3.68kW, initial tariff of 650€/MWh for...

A major part of decentralised production in the Netherlands consists of Combined Heat and Power-plants (CHP). Especially in the horticultural sector small CHP-plants with a maximum rating of 2,5 MW are applied. In these areas the CHP-plants are connected to the Medium voltage grid which leads to a high penetration level of CHP-plants. The Dutch law obliges grid operators to connect CHP-plants to the...
